Where to Buy a German Shepherd

German Shepherds are very active dogs that require a lot of exercise to get rid of energy. If they don't, they could become bored and develop behaviour problems, such as chewing shoes or couches.

52526780752_05caa47e32_h-1024x772.jpgGerman Shepherd ownership is a long term commitment and financial responsibility. Knowing the costs is crucial.

Find a breeder that is skilled in.

German Shepherds require a daily dose of physical activity. They are energetic and intelligent dogs. They are not suited to all households, and they require experienced pet parents who are able to provide them with a large amount of exercise, mental stimulation, and training. These dogs can become aggressive or destructive if not active enough. They are also susceptible to certain health conditions that include bloat (a twisting of the stomach) and hip dysplasia. A gastropexy, a surgical procedure that permanently bonds the stomach to the inside of the body's wall, reduces the risk of developing these conditions.

When searching for a German Shepherd puppy, it is essential to choose an experienced breeder that specializes in this particular dog. This will ensure that the puppies are healthy and have a great temperament. A breeder who is specialized can match you with a puppy that best suits your family's needs and lifestyle.

The process of choosing a breeder can be an intimidating task, especially for those who are new dog owners. Unfortunately, there are many unprofessional breeders who are looking to make money and are not concerned with the health and welfare of their puppies. It is best to avoid this trap by choosing breeders who are accredited by an association like the American Kennel Club. This will ensure that the breeder follows strict standards and isn't engaging in any illegal practices.

It is essential to ask questions regarding the breeding practices of a breeder you are able to trust. Check the health clearances of the parents as well as their background. You can also inquire about the kind of environment that the puppies are raised in, as well as whether they are provided with early socialization and appropriate health care.

Discuss with your veterinarian the ethical breeders near you. Veterinarians have lots of experience working with animal caregivers in the community, including shelters and breeders.

German Shepherds are intelligent dogs that are well-receptive to training. They are excellent companions and service dogs. They also make excellent guard dogs because of their instinctual nature and alertness. They are naturally wary of strangers and will bark to alert their owners if they spot threats. This is not a sign that the dog is aggressive so long as it is in control.

German Shepherds are a herding breed of dog and require regular exercise to help burn off their energy. They are perfect for families who love running, hiking, and playing fetch. They will also excel at sporting events for dogs, such as obedience training and agility. They are generally very content and energetic dogs and will be extremely close to their owners.

Breeders with a good reputation screen their male and Female dogs for genetic disorders like hip dysplasia and eye diseases. They also look for bloat (gastric dilation and volvulus) and degenerative myelopathy cancer and other health problems.

A reputable breeder makes sure that their puppies are neutered, vaccinated, or spayed and are healthy before they are sent to their new homes. They will also provide the health guarantee and contract to provide pet owners with peace of peace of.

It is also a good idea to visit the breeding center prior to purchasing a German Shepherd. This will allow you to meet the adult dogs and observe how they interact with the puppies. A good breeder will welcome visitors to their premises and allow you to play with the puppies. They will also offer tips and recommendations for classes for dogs in the area.

The German Shepherd Dog, or Alsatian in the UK is a loyal and intelligent breed originally created to herd sheep. Nowadays they are trained to work in police, as service and bomb detection dogs, for forensics and therapy, as well as horses for equestrian use. This breed has an inherent need to work and are happiest when they are involved in something.

They require a lot of physical activity. They are best for people with a large yard so that they can play to their fullest. If you're not able to give them this, then they will be bored and can end up being destructive. They also shed heavily and if you're allergic to dogs, this might not be the ideal choice for you.
